The beauty of the Pinterest Challenge lies in its simplicity and flexibility. There’s only one core rule: select something inspirational you’ve pinned and put your unique, personal spin on it. This means you’re not striving for a perfect replication, but rather using the original project as a springboard for your own creativity. Crucially, we ask participants to always link back to the original creator of the inspiring project. Whether it’s a major company like Anthropologie or a fellow blogger whose ingenious idea sparked your imagination, giving credit where it’s due is a fundamental part of our creative community. We particularly enjoy finding inspiration from sites that feature “Pin It” buttons, as this indicates they appreciate being shared and discovered on Pinterest.

What kind of project can you undertake? Anything your heart desires! The scope is truly limitless. Your chosen project can be grand or modest, a quick afternoon craft or a weekend-long endeavor. It could fall into the realm of home decor, sewing, cooking, gardening, or something entirely unexpected. The goal isn’t perfection; it’s participation, experimentation, and the immense satisfaction of turning a digital image into something real that you can admire, use, or even consume. The Big Reveal: Elegant Hallway Wainscoting!

The answer, dear readers, is: Wainscoting! We’re planning to install this beautiful architectural detail down both sides of our long hallway. And no, this isn’t the frame hallway; it’s the one that leads to the guest room, hall bath, nursery, and playroom. Our primary goal is to inject some much-needed character and break up that “bowling alley feeling” of the long, bare hall. Wainscoting will add visual interest, a sense of history, and a touch of sophistication, transforming a utilitarian passageway into an inviting part of our home.

img 55871 3

To be perfectly technical, what we’re going to implement is likely closer to what’s known as “board and batten.” While traditional wainscoting often involves panels, board and batten achieves a similar effect using vertical strips (battens) over a baseboard and sometimes a cap, creating a geometric pattern.
